Safety and usage
*Minimum distances:
- Handgun: ≥ 10 yards
- Rifle ≤ 3,000 fps muzzle: ≥ 100 yards; increase distance if you observe pitting
- Rifle > 3,000 fps muzzle: ≥ 200 yards; increase distance if you observe pitting
Use quality eye and ear protection, inspect targets before use and replace any plate that shows cratering or severe pitting. Repaint regularly to track impacts and surface health.

Why ½” Steel instead of ⅜”? For long-range and magnum use, mass matters. ½” AR500 is thicker and heavier, allowing it to absorb the energy of large calibers like .338 Lapua without warping or pitting.
Do I need special lumber? No. The brackets are designed to fit standard 2×4 studs available at any local hardware store.
Why use Rubber Chains? Rubber chains are “self-healing.” Unlike steel chains that can shatter if hit, bullets pass through the rubber, extending the life of your hanging hardware significantly.
How is laser-cutting better?
CNC laser-cutting tightly controls the heat-affected zone, preserves hardness at the edge and yields a cleaner perimeter than plasma cutting. This means longer plate life and safer splatter.
Does it ship painted?
No. We ship unpainted so you can apply your preferred color. White or bright orange offer the best contrast downrange.
